CHICAGO, Ill. - The Kalamazoo College men's lacrosse team improved to 2-0 with a 16-9 win at Concordia Chicago on Saturday.
Kalamazoo led 3-0 after the first quarter, but trailed 5-3 midway through the second. Kalamazoo scored five straight goals to end the half up 8-5.
The Hornets led 12-7 after the third and led by at least five goals the rest of the way.
Kalamazoo outshot Concordia 54-28 overall.
Brett Fitzgerald and Zach Morales led the Hornets with three goals apiece.
Brandon Wright, Dylan McGorisk, and Jack Loveland each scored twice.
Jack Smith broke his own school record with seven assists in the contest.
Nate Silverman made nine saves in goal.
Kalamazoo returns to action Sunday afternoon with a match at Carroll University in Wisconsin.
